Paul E. McKenney 68d415f91f refscale: Allow CPU hotplug to be enabled
It is no longer possible to disable CPU hotplug in many configurations,
which means that the CONFIG_HOTPLUG_CPU=n lines in refscale's Kconfig
options are just a source of useless diagnostics.  In addition, refscale
doesn't do CPU-hotplug operations in any case.  This commit therefore
changes these lines to read CONFIG_HOTPLUG_CPU=y.
